For and in consideration of the Grantee's agreement to reconstruct
and improve a segment of Bowman Creek located on or adjacent to
Grantor(s) real estate, Grantor(s) hereby grant(s) and convey(s) to
Grantee a perpetual easement at the location hereinafter set forth for
the reconstruction, reinforcement, widening, improvement, operation
and maintenance of Bowman Creek, together with the right of ingress to
and egress from said easement for the purpose of reconstructing,
improving, repairing and maintaining said Bowman Creek and other
facilities incident thereto, in, upon, over and under the following
described real estate in the City of South Bend, St. Joseph County,
State of Indiana, more particularly described as follows:

The easement rights granted herein shall pertain to the air,
surface, and subsurface rights and interests of the Grantor(s), for
the use and benefit of the Grantee, to the nature and extent that the
Grantee may desire or need said air, surface and subsurface rights and
interests to reasonably accomplish and carry out the general purpose
of this conveyance as the same has hereinabove been expressed. The
easement hereby granted is for the benefit of the city of South Bend
and expressly includes the right and privilege at reasonable time to
clean and remove from said easement timber, brush, debris, structures
or other obstructions interfering with the operation of Bowman Creek
and the free flow of storm water.
Grantee shall have the right of ingress or egress over Grantor's
real estate adjoining said easement when necessary to install,
construct, operate, maintain, adjust, replace, repair, alter, remove,
or modernize the Bowman Creek improvements.
Grantee will restore the area disturbed by its work to a condition
as good or better than the original condition consistent with the
improvements to be made to Bowman Creek.

Grantor(s) reserve(s) the right to use the surface area of the
easement provided that such use does not disrupt or disturb the
improvements made by the Grantee. Grantor(s) shall not erect any
structure on the easement area or allow any object to be placed
thereon that would retard the free flow of storm water.
The easement granted herein and its associated benefits and
obligations, shall constitute covenants running with the real estate,
and shall be binding upon the Grantor(s) and be an obligation thereof
of every person or entity now or hereafter having any fee, leasehold,
or other interest in all or any part of the said real estate.
This indenture shall bind and inure to the benefit of the
respective successors and assigns of the parties hereto.
Grantor(s) hereby release(s) any and all claims from whatsoever
cause, incidental to the exercise of any rights herein granted.
